Duda is looking for an outstanding Product Designer (UX/UI) to join our design guild in Israel. This is a unique opportunity to join a successful team of professionals and work with cutting-edge technologies.

As a Product Designer, you’ll take part in building our next-generation website-building platform used by web professionals and agencies around the world. 

This is a full-time position with a hybrid attendance arrangement of 3 days from the office and 2 days from home.


WHAT YOU’LL BE DOING

  • Be part of an exciting environment, and play a significant role in defining, building, and launching beautiful, simple, innovative, and impactful solutions for our users.
  • Contribute to the company’s OKRs, product strategy, and vision by closely collaborating with product managers, engineers, copywriters, fellow designers, and other stakeholders.
  • Own the design process from initial concept to pixel-perfect design. This includes research, wireframes, flowcharts, prototypes, and UI design. 
  • Identify data-driven and feedback-based UX optimizations, conduct user research and testing, and ensure a consistent and successful user journey. 
  • Help shape all guild initiatives and functions, such as the company’s Design System, guidelines, processes, culture, and education.
  • Provide inspiration, mentorship, and feedback to fellow designers with their projects and professional development.

THE IDEAL CANDIDATE FOR THIS POSITION 

  • Has a minimum of 4 years of experience in shipping products and working as part of an agile product team. 
  • Is a pixel-perfect freak with a keen eye for detail and a knack for design solutions.
  • Has hands-on experience in the UX design process, including research, ideation,  testing, visual design, and prototyping.
  • Is a team player with excellent communication skills, both verbal and written. 
  • Is a storyteller who can develop and distill concepts and brainstorm ideas.
  • Is always at the forefront of visual and UX trends and constantly advancing their skills.
  • Stays mindful of how to strike the right balance between business goals and user needs in every step of the way.
  • Is a problem-solver and human-centered, strives to understand people's needs, motivations, and behaviors and drive them toward impactful results.
  • Is fluent in Figma.
  • Has experience working with design systems.

What you need to know about the Los Angeles Tech Scene

Los Angeles is a global leader in entertainment, so it’s no surprise that many of the biggest players in streaming, digital media and game development call the city home. But the city boasts plenty of non-entertainment innovation as well, with tech companies spanning verticals like AI, fintech, e-commerce and biotech. With major universities like Caltech, UCLA, USC and the nearby UC Irvine, the city has a steady supply of top-flight tech and engineering talent — not counting the graduates flocking to Los Angeles from across the world to enjoy its beaches, culture and year-round temperate climate.

Key Facts About Los Angeles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 375,800; 5.5%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Snap, Netflix, SpaceX, Disney, Google
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, adtech, media, software, game development
  • Funding Landscape: $11.6 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Strong Ventures, Fifth Wall, Upfront Ventures, Mucker Capital, Kittyhawk Ventures
  • Research Centers and Universities: California Institute of Technology, UCLA, University of Southern California, UC Irvine, Pepperdine, California Institute for Immunology and Immunotherapy, Center for Quantum Science and Engineering
